Miter Saws for Aluminium Cutting: Selecting the Right Equipment
Cutting aluminum profiles with a compound saw requires careful consideration. While many models can handle it, not all are created equal; some offer superior results and longevity. Look for blades specifically designed for non-ferrous metals – often described as “abrasive cut” or featuring high teeth. A slow blade speed is also crucial to prevent scorching and melting of the aluminium, which can compromise the edge’s quality and create hazardous fumes. Consider a saw with a dust collection system, as aluminum dust presents both health and fire risks. Finally, assess the material thickness you regularly work with; a sliding miter saw offers greater capacity for thicker profiles, while a fixed-head model may suffice for smaller projects and provide more stability.

Cutting Aluminium with Miter Saws - Tips and Tricks
Successfully trimming metal with a miter saw requires some unique techniques. Firstly , use a fine-tooth blade designed for non-ferrous materials; a standard wood circular saw will quickly become worn. Reducing the speed, often to around 1500 RPM, is also important to prevent melting and a rough cut. Moreover , applying cutting fluid – such as mineral oil – can drastically reduce heat buildup and improve the appearance of your slice . Finally, remember to regularly wear eye protection as aluminum particles are often sharp .
